硬盘软故障处理有道-硬盘的软故障即非物理性故障,比如主引导记录、分区表、启动文件等被破坏而导致系统无法启动,硬盘被病毒感染造成无法运行,以及非法操作、维护不当等。
主引导记录损坏
由于病毒的破坏或操作上的失误,使硬盘主引导记录损坏,硬盘将无法启动。开机后系统提示“diskbootfailure,insertsystemdiskandpressenter”,告诉您找不到启动分区硬盘或者硬盘上没有启动文件,请插入启动盘后按“回车”键。如果bios中的硬盘设置正确,而且可以从软盘或光盘启动后能找到您的硬盘,那么您的机器不过是因为windows启动文件或硬盘的主引导扇区被破坏罢了。
硬盘的主引导扇区是硬盘中的 为敏感的一个部件,其中的主引导程序用于检测硬盘分区的正确性并确定活动分区,负责把引导权移交给活动分区的dos或其他操作系统,此段程序损坏将无法从硬盘引导。
修复此故障 简单的方法就是使用高版本dos的fdisk带参数/mbr运行(即执行“fdisk/mbr”命令),直接覆盖(重写)硬盘的主引导程序(fdisk.exe之中包含完整的硬盘主引导程序)的代码区。由于从dos时代直到目前的windows系统,硬盘的主引导程序一直没有变化,所以只要找到一种dos引导盘启动系统并运行此程序即可修复。 在硬盘主引导扇区中还存在一个非常重要的部分,那就是其 后的两个字节:55aa,此为扇区的有效标志。当从硬盘、软盘或光区启动时,将检测这两个字节,如果存在则认为有硬盘存在,否则将不承认硬盘。
★fixmbr★
fixmbr是一个dos下的应用小工具,只有12kb,专门用于重新构造主引导扇区。直接运行fixmbr,它将检查mbr结构,如果发现系统不正常则会出现是否进行修复的提示。如果回答“yes”,它将搜索分区。当搜索到相应的分区以后,系统会提示是否修改mbr,回答“yes”则开始自动修复。如果这时出现死机现象,请将bios中的防病毒功能禁止后再做。缺省的状态下将搜索所有已经存在的硬盘,并完成以上操作。如果完成的结果不对,可以用“/z”参数将结果清空后重新启动,就可以恢复到原来的状态。
执行“fixmbr/?”可得到fixmbr的帮助信息如下:
usage:fixmbr[driveno][/a][/d][/p][/z][/h]
drivenoharddiskscope0-3,defaultisalldrive.(指硬盘号,0表示第一个硬盘)
/aactivedospartition.(激活基本dos分区)
/pdisplaypartition.(显示dos分区的结构)
/ddisplaymbr.(显示主引导记录内容)
/zzerombr.(将主引导记录填零)
/hthismessage.(本帮助信息) fixmbr的下载地址http://gwbnsh.pchome.net/utility/antivirus/av98/fixmbr.exe。
★kv3000★
kv3000具有非常强大的主引导记录和分区修复的功能。我们可以先用软盘启动后,执行kv3000,按下“f6”键,就可查看已经不能引导的硬盘隐含扇区,即查看硬盘0面0柱1扇区主引导信息是否正常。如果在这里没有找到关键代码,即硬盘分区表关键代码“80”、“55aa”,那么硬盘本身将不能引导,即使软盘引导后也不能进入硬盘。这时,可按动翻页键“pgdn”或“pgup”键,在硬盘的隐含扇区内查找,如有,会在表中出现闪动的红色“80”和“55aa”,并响一声来提示你,下行会出现一行提示,“f9=savetoside0cylinder0sector1!!!”。这时,按一下“f9”键,就可将刚找到的在表中显示出的原硬盘主引导信息,覆盖到硬盘0面0柱1扇区中,然后机器会重新引导硬盘,恢复硬盘的主引导记录。
硬盘被“逻辑锁”锁定
“硬盘逻辑锁”是一种很常见的恶作剧手段。中了逻辑锁之后,无论使用什么设备都不能正常引导系统,甚至是软盘、光驱、挂双硬盘都一样没有任何作用。
“逻辑锁”的上锁原理:计算机在引导dos系统时将会搜索所有逻辑盘的顺序,当dos被引导时,首先要去找主引导扇区的分区表信息,然后查找各扩展分区的逻辑盘。“逻辑锁”修改了正常的主引导分区记录,将扩展分区的第一个逻辑盘指向自己,使得dos在启动时查找到第一个逻辑盘后,查找下个逻辑盘总是找到自己,这样一来就形成了死循环。
给“逻辑锁”解锁比较容易的方法是“热拔插”硬盘电源。就是在当系统启动时,先不给被锁的硬盘加电,启动完成后再给硬盘“热插”上电源线,这样系统就可以正常控制硬盘了。这是一种非常危险的方法,为了降低危险程度,碰到“逻辑锁”后,大家 好依照下面两种比较简单和安全的方法处理。
★ultraedit★
首先准备一张启动盘,然后在其他正常的机器上使用二进制编辑工具(推荐ultraedit)修改软盘上的io.sys文件(修改前记住先将该文件的属性改为正常),具体是在这个文件里面搜索第一个“55aa”字符串,找到以后修改为任何其他数值即可。用这张修改过的系统软盘你就可以顺利地带着被锁的硬盘启动了。不过这时由于该硬盘正常的分区表已经被破坏,你无法用“fdisk”来删除和修改分区,但是此时可以用前面介绍的关于分区表恢复的方法来处理。
ultraeditv9.00b汉化版的下载地
推荐阅读
-
湖南阳光电子技术学校-欢迎您!
相关文章
-   硬盘保护的几点经验
-   你的硬盘数据突然丢失
-   丢失的USB移动硬盘
-   主板维修新方法
-   拯救硬盘十大绝招
-   为硬盘不启动找“理
-   延长硬盘寿命的技巧
-   硬盘故障修复数据技巧
-   低格能解决坏道问题吗
-   制作启动型闪存盘
-   解决硬盘高级格式
-   硬盘十大故障解决方法
-   已报废硬盘修复记
-   报废”硬盘复活记
-   硬盘软故障处理有道
-   笔本电脑维修收费标准
-   遭遇另类80针数据线
-   硬盘线也惹祸
-   教你几条延长硬盘
-   显示器偏色修理实战
网站: http://www.hnygpx.net 报名电话:0731-5579057 13807313137 报名信箱: yp5579@263.net 咨询QQ: 361928696,873219118
校址:湖南省长沙市雨花区红花坡路176号(正圆厂内)。 来校路线:长沙火车站售票处后坪乘135路至"鼓风站"下车,回走100米即到 湘ICP备08002401